Revolutionizing Code Efficiency: Exploring the Undergraduate Certificate in Advanced C Programming Techniques and Tools

Revolutionizing Code Efficiency: Exploring the Undergraduate Certificate in Advanced C Programming Techniques and Tools

Discover the future of coding with the Undergraduate Certificate in Advanced C Programming, equipping you with cutting-edge skills for IoT, AI, and cybersecurity applications.

In the rapidly evolving world of computer science, the demand for efficient and skilled programmers has never been more pressing. As technology continues to advance at breakneck speed, the need for professionals who can harness the power of C programming has become increasingly crucial. The Undergraduate Certificate in Advanced C Programming Techniques and Tools is a specialized program designed to equip students with the cutting-edge skills required to stay ahead of the curve. In this blog post, we'll delve into the latest trends, innovations, and future developments in this field, highlighting the exciting opportunities and challenges that lie ahead.

The Rise of IoT and Embedded Systems: Leveraging C Programming for Real-World Applications

The Internet of Things (IoT) has revolutionized the way we live and work, with an estimated 75 billion devices expected to be connected by 2025. As IoT continues to expand, the demand for skilled C programmers who can develop efficient, scalable, and secure code for embedded systems has skyrocketed. The Undergraduate Certificate in Advanced C Programming Techniques and Tools is perfectly positioned to address this need, providing students with a deep understanding of C programming principles, data structures, and algorithms. By mastering these skills, students can develop innovative solutions for IoT applications, such as smart home devices, wearable technology, and autonomous vehicles.

Artificial Intelligence and Machine Learning: The Role of C Programming in Emerging Technologies

Artificial intelligence (AI) and machine learning (ML) are transforming industries and revolutionizing the way we approach complex problems. C programming plays a vital role in the development of AI and ML algorithms, which are often used in conjunction with other languages like Python and R. The Undergraduate Certificate in Advanced C Programming Techniques and Tools provides students with a solid foundation in C programming, enabling them to develop high-performance AI and ML applications. By leveraging C programming, students can optimize AI and ML algorithms, reduce computational overhead, and improve overall system efficiency.

Cybersecurity and Code Optimization: The Critical Role of C Programming in Secure Coding Practices

In today's digital landscape, cybersecurity is a top priority, with the average cost of a data breach exceeding $3.9 million. C programming plays a critical role in secure coding practices, as it provides a low-level, memory-safe way to develop software. The Undergraduate Certificate in Advanced C Programming Techniques and Tools emphasizes the importance of secure coding practices, teaching students how to write efficient, secure, and reliable code. By mastering C programming, students can develop secure software applications, identify vulnerabilities, and implement effective countermeasures to prevent cyber threats.

The Future of C Programming: Emerging Trends and Innovations

As technology continues to evolve, C programming is likely to play an increasingly important role in emerging trends and innovations. Some of the exciting developments on the horizon include the use of C programming in quantum computing, blockchain technology, and augmented reality applications. The Undergraduate Certificate in Advanced C Programming Techniques and Tools is designed to equip students with the skills and knowledge required to adapt to these emerging trends, providing a solid foundation for a career in C programming.

In conclusion, the Undergraduate Certificate in Advanced C Programming Techniques and Tools is a cutting-edge program that provides students with the skills and knowledge required to succeed in the rapidly evolving world of computer science. By leveraging the power of C programming, students can develop innovative solutions for IoT applications, AI and ML algorithms, and secure coding practices. As technology continues to advance, the demand for skilled C programmers will only continue to grow, making this program an exciting and rewarding career choice for aspiring programmers.

7,468 views
Back to Blogs